> The STAG was not a ship, but a shore
> establishment, the name used for the base for
> British naval personnel in Egypt.
> First established at Port Said, it commissioned 8
> January 1940. There were outposts at Adabya,
> Kabrit, Ismailia, Generiffa, Port Tewfik, all of
> which came under 'HMS STAG'.
> It finally paid off in May 1949.
